Where to buy botulinum toxin safely online

When considering purchasing botulinum toxin online, safety and legitimacy should be your top priorities. Botulinum toxin, commonly known by brand names like Botox, Dysport, or Xeomin, is a prescription medication used for both medical and cosmetic purposes. While the internet offers convenience, it’s crucial to approach online purchases with caution to avoid counterfeit products, unverified sellers, or legal complications.

First and foremost, always consult a licensed healthcare provider before using botulinum toxin. A qualified professional can assess your needs, recommend appropriate treatment, and provide guidance on safe sourcing. In many countries, botulinum toxin is classified as a prescription-only medication, meaning it cannot legally be sold without oversight from a medical practitioner. If a website claims to sell it without requiring a prescription, that’s a major red flag.

If you’re looking for a reputable source, prioritize platforms that emphasize transparency and compliance with medical regulations. When evaluating an online seller, check for verifiable credentials. Legitimate suppliers should openly display information about their licensing, partnerships with pharmaceutical companies, and adherence to safety standards. Look for certifications from organizations like the FDA (U.S. Food and Drug Administration) or EMA (European Medicines Agency), depending on your location. Avoid websites with vague descriptions, unclear origins of products, or overly aggressive marketing tactics.

Another key factor is customer reviews and third-party verification. Reputable sellers will have genuine testimonials from clients, often accompanied by before-and-after photos or detailed accounts of their experiences. Be wary of platforms with overly positive reviews that lack specificity—these could be fabricated. Independent review sites or forums can also provide unbiased insights into a seller’s reliability.

Price is another consideration. While it’s tempting to opt for the cheapest option, botulinum toxin is a medical-grade product with strict manufacturing requirements. Extremely low prices often indicate substandard or counterfeit substances. Authentic products come with batch numbers, expiration dates, and tamper-evident packaging. If these details aren’t provided or seem questionable, steer clear.

Legal compliance is equally important. Purchasing botulinum toxin without a prescription or from an unlicensed supplier may violate local laws, potentially leading to fines, confiscation of products, or even health risks. Always verify that the seller operates within the legal framework of your country. For instance, in the U.S., botulinum toxin must be administered by a licensed professional, and its distribution is tightly controlled.
